The rebalancing tool now prioritizes dock clusters flagged as chronically empty rather than pure trip-demand forecasts, which shifts truck routes toward outer neighborhoods during morning peaks. Support should expect questions from depot leads about shorter routes downtown; this is intended. The minimum-fill alert threshold also dropped from 20% to 15%, so alert volume will rise slightly for the first week. No action is needed on existing deployments; upgraded instances pick up the new defaults automatically, as listed below.

deployment values, yadug-bawif:
[framir]
team = pelox
access_code = ac_a38ab2
owner = tamion.julael
host = framir.tolvaqlabs.test
port = 11211
peer = tammir.zemvargrid.local
salt = 2215ef03
pin = 1541

Our commercial insurance package with Pellworth Mutual renews at the end of the fiscal year. The quoted premium is up 14%, driven largely by the expanded Harrowgate warehouse and last year's liability claim. We obtained two comparison quotes; neither matched Pellworth's coverage on equipment breakdown. Finance recommends renewing at the quoted rate while increasing the property deductible to offset roughly half the increase. Cash impact is manageable within the existing Q1 envelope. One strategic consideration bears directly on this decision.

management briefing: The renewal with Zoraelax Group closes at $10 million a year, 15 percent below the last contract. Project Ralael slips by six weeks because of the audit delay.

Subject: Config hot-reload ownership change

Plugin authors: ownership of the Vexline hot-reload subsystem has moved off the Platform Core team. Effective next sprint, all questions about reload hooks, debounce timing, and the watcher API go to the new owner. Open issues will be re-triaged this week. No API changes planned, but expect updated docs for reload callbacks. New point of contact follows.

signatory, kaweg-fawig: Zorys Druys Jorius Novael

Subject: Quickstore 4.2 — bloom filter now fronts the KV layer

Plugin authors: starting with this release, Quickstore places a bloom filter ahead of the key-value store. Negative lookups return faster; false positives fall through safely. No API changes are required on your side. Verify your plugin against the staging build referenced below.

session token of fahif-tadup = htk3_9c7